  4. 13 de dic. de 2021 · Original broadcast on Channel 4 on Christmas Day 1991 this one off musical special took a look at the history and haunts of Oxford Street, London, starring and directed by Malcolm McLaren. Featuring the music of The Happy Mondays, Rebel MC, Sir Tom Jones, Sinead O'Connor, The Pogues with Kirsty MacColl and Alison Limerick.
